Leather Dye

Has anyone ever had any luck with changing the color of their leather seats.

I have been searching frantically for some 4th gen seats to put into my 84 camaro and Now i have finally found someone with some for fairly cheap except they are tanish/brown and my interior is gray...

Iv found a few products on ebay etc.. that claim they can w/ no fading but I personally think there is no way. But I thought I would check to see if anyone else did something like this.

Damn, waited two years for a reply.

I dyed mine with SEM aresol wayyy back in 97 (graphite-black).Leather is showing wear/cracking, but the dye is still fine.
